. WKBC's morning show, hosted by Steve Handy, features the "WKBC Hometown Opry" the second Friday of each month. The Opry features live performances by local, regional, and even national folk and bluegrass musicians. Wilkes County's location as the site of the annual MerleFest - the largest folk and bluegrass music festival in the nation - has led to the Hometown Opry attracting prominent musicians in folk and bluegrass music. Eric Ellis, a regular on "Hometown Opry", was inducted into the Blue Ridge Music Hall of Fame in January 2009.
